Autographa californicaNucleopolyhedrovirus Infection Results in Sf9 Cell Cycle Arrest at G2/M Phase

Abstract: Baculovirus infection results in the induction of membrane structures within the nucleoplasm of the host cells. The source of these membranes is unclear; however, using the normal dynamics of cellular membranes and the nuclear envelope as a model, it is possible that the cell cycle might play a role in the regulation of formation of these intranuclear membranes. Therefore, one goal of this study was to investigate the effect of baculovirus infection on the cell cycle of Sf9 host cells. Since few data are avail… Show more

“…There have been various studies reporting perturbations in cell cycle and apoptotic mechanisms after baculovirus infection. In one study, AcMNPV was observed to arrest the Sf9 cell cycle at the G 2 /M stage (Braunagel et al, 1998) whilst in another study, synchronized Sf9 cells when infected at the G 1 or S phase were arrested in the S phase, whilst those infected at the G 2 /M stage were blocked at the G 2 /M stage (Ikeda & Kobayashi, 1999). In yet another study, Helicoverpa armigera nucleopolyhedrovirus was found to arrest cell growth at the G 2 /M stage (Zhou et al, 2004).…”
